Output 6ab3b3f966bcfa764bae86abb7652ac3a4835a6d9d50582a7c287eed24aab38b:1

value
3152181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f1c2d24a8497817dd5be991094c6729c958133 OP_EQUAL
address
3EuQr1yPc34AwTXNXDJPLqaWvVfm7CsWvD
transaction
6ab3b3f966bcfa764bae86abb7652ac3a4835a6d9d50582a7c287eed24aab38b
spent
true